What Is Web3?
Web3 is the next generation of the internet built on blockchain technology. Unlike traditional platforms, Web3 gives users control over their data, identity, and digital assets.
Key Features of Web3:
- Decentralization (no central authority)
- Blockchain-based transactions
- User ownership of digital assets
- Smart contracts for automation
Popular Web3 ecosystems include Ethereum and Solana, which power decentralized applications (dApps).
What Is the Metaverse?
The metaverse is a virtual digital world where users can interact, socialize, work, and play using avatars.
It combines:
- Virtual reality (VR)
- Augmented reality (AR)
- Blockchain technology
- Digital economies
Platforms like Decentraland and The Sandbox allow users to own virtual land, trade assets, and build experiences.

Key Technologies Powering the Metaverse & Web3
1. Blockchain
Blockchain ensures transparency, security, and decentralization. It records all transactions and ownership data.
2. NFTs (Non-Fungible Tokens)
NFTs represent unique digital assets such as:
- Virtual land
- Art
- Avatars
- In-game items
They enable true ownership in the metaverse.
3. Smart Contracts
Self-executing contracts that automate transactions without intermediaries.
4. Virtual Reality (VR) & Augmented Reality (AR)
Devices like Meta Quest 3 enhance immersive experiences in virtual environments.
5. Cryptocurrencies
Digital currenc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um power transactions and economies in Web3 platforms.

Challenges and Risks
1. Scalability Issues
Blockchain networks can be slow and expensive.
2. Security Concerns
Smart contract vulnerabilities and scams exist.
3. Regulatory Uncertainty
Governments are still defining rules for Web3.
4. High Entry Barrier
VR equipment and crypto knowledge can be limiting.
5. Market Volatility
Crypto prices can fluctuate significantly.
